diff --git a/debian/patches/MOK-BootServicesData.patch b/debian/patches/MOK-BootServicesData.patch deleted file mode 100644 index 948b89b9..00000000 --- a/debian/patches/MOK-BootServicesData.patch +++ /dev/null @@ -1,34 +0,0 @@ -commit 4068fd42c891ea6ebdec056f461babc6e4048844 -Author: Gary Lin <glin@suse.com> -Date: Thu Apr 8 16:23:03 2021 +0800 - - mok: allocate MOK config table as BootServicesData - - Linux kernel is picky when reserving the memory for x86 and it only - expects BootServicesData: - - https://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/torvalds/linux.git/tree/arch/x86/platform/efi/quirks.c?h=v5.11#n254 - - Otherwise, the following error would show during system boot: - - Apr 07 12:31:56.743925 localhost kernel: efi: Failed to lookup EFI memory descriptor for 0x000000003dcf8000 - - Although BootServicesData would be reclaimed after ExitBootService(), - linux kernel reserves MOK config table when it detects the existence of - the table, so it's fine to allocate the table as BootServicesData. - - Signed-off-by: Gary Lin <glin@suse.com> - -diff --git a/mok.c b/mok.c -index 9e37d6ab..9b8fc2bc 100644 ---- a/mok.c -+++ b/mok.c -@@ -999,7 +999,7 @@ EFI_STATUS import_mok_state(EFI_HANDLE image_handle) - npages = ALIGN_VALUE(config_sz, PAGE_SIZE) >> EFI_PAGE_SHIFT; - config_table = NULL; - efi_status = gBS->AllocatePages(AllocateAnyPages, -- EfiRuntimeServicesData, -+ EfiBootServicesData, - npages, - (EFI_PHYSICAL_ADDRESS *)&config_table); - if (EFI_ERROR(efi_status) || !config_table) { |
